Pro Honduran Liberty Rally Today

At el parque de la libertad 13th Avenue and SW 8th Street at 3pm.

I received a plea for help to inform the public about this rally. Liberty loving Hondurans are concerned about how the media is spinning events in their country. Show your support and attend the rally.
